Overview of Gingko Biloba

Property Description
Active ingredient Flavone glycosides, Terpene lactones (Ginkgolides, Bilobalide)
Form Tablet, capsule, liquid extract (Oral route)
Pharmacological class Phytomedicine, Vasoregulator, Nootropic Agent
Common use Supports memory and concentration, aids circulation
Origin Dried leaves of the Ginkgo biloba tree

What Type of Medicine is Standardized Ginkgo Biloba Extract?

Standardized Ginkgo biloba extract (GBE) is formally classified as a phytomedicine, which is a medicinal product derived directly from a plant source, placing it in the pharmacological classes of vasoregulator and nootropic agent. The active substance originates exclusively from the dried leaves of the Ginkgo biloba tree. Unlike general herbal preparations, GBE is characterized by a consistent composition.

Standardized Ginkgo biloba extract is classified as a traditional herbal medicinal product, intended for supporting cognitive performance. The extract is typically formulated for the oral route, available as tablets, capsules, or liquid extracts, intended primarily for the adult and geriatric populations seeking support for circulatory and cognitive health.

Active Ingredients: The Composition and Standardization of Ginkgo

The active constituents defining the quality of Ginkgo biloba extract are a precise mixture of flavone glycosides and terpene lactones, including specific ginkgolides and bilobalide. These compounds are obtained using a controlled hydro-ethanolic solvent for extraction. Standardization is critical to the identity of GBE; it dictates that the final product must contain specific ratios, ensuring reliable dosing consistency and distinguishing it from non-standardized supplements.

The extract contains antioxidants that can help improve blood flow by dilating blood vessels, which is a key pharmacological feature of GBE.

General Purpose: What Functions Does Ginkgo Biloba Extract Support?

The extract's overall utility is based on effects which include promoting microcirculation enhancement and offering antioxidant activity. These mechanisms help improve blood flow, notably cerebral blood flow, while providing general neuronal protection. This combined action forms the basis for the extract's general purpose: to help support healthy cognitive enhancement, focusing on aspects such as memory and concentration, and to assist in improving circulatory efficiency in the peripheral blood vessels.

What side effects are possible with Gingko Biloba?

Possible side effects and safety information

Standardized Ginkgo biloba extract (GBE) has an officially documented safety profile characterized by both common, generally mild adverse reactions and specific constraints relating to bleeding risk, as detailed in regulatory documents.

Frequency-Classified Adverse Reactions

The most frequently reported adverse reactions are classified as Common (may affect up to 1 in 10 people) and typically involve the nervous system and the gastrointestinal system. These include headache, dizziness, and various gastrointestinal disturbances such as abdominal pain, nausea, or diarrhea. Less common reactions are classified as Uncommon or Rare and often consist of hypersensitivity reactions, such as rash and pruritus.

Serious Safety Constraints and Special Populations

The most significant safety concern documented in regulatory labels relates to the potential for bleeding events, including sporadic reports of spontaneous cerebral or ocular hemorrhage. The frequency of these serious events is typically classified as Not Known or very rare. Consequently, GBE is subject to specific constraints:

  • Pre-Surgical Discontinuation: Official regulatory safety notes advise that the extract should be discontinued several days prior to any surgical procedures to minimize the documented risk of increased bleeding.
  • Contraindications: Use is contraindicated in patients with a pathologically increased bleeding tendency (haemorrhagic diathesis), known hypersensitivity to the extract, and during pregnancy.
  • Cautionary Use: Caution is mandated for patients with epilepsy and those concurrently using other medicines that affect blood clotting, such as anticoagulants or antiplatelet drugs.

Overdose and Emergency Response

Overdose and When to Seek Help

The official regulatory profile for Standardized Ginkgo biloba Extract (GBE) focuses on documented serious adverse events rather than a universally reported overdose syndrome. Some national authorities note that no specific human overdose cases have been reported for the standardized leaf extract; however, guidance exists for managing potential over-ingestion.

Documented Risks and Manifestations

Classification Manifestation/Risk
Hemorrhagic Risk Potential for bleeding disorders, including reports of cerebral hemorrhage, ocular, or gastrointestinal bleeding.
Neurological Risk Heightened risk of seizures, particularly in patients with a history of epilepsy.
Common Manifestations Documented signs include headache, dizziness, and gastrointestinal complaints like nausea and diarrhea.

Emergency Actions Mandated by Regulators

If overdosage is suspected, the official required action is to seek immediate medical attention and contact a poison control center or emergency room at once.

Management of over-ingestion is limited to symptomatic and supportive treatment, as no specific antidote for GBE is documented. Urgent medical help is necessary when any severe or life-threatening symptoms, such as significant bleeding or seizure activity, are observed.

Eligibility and Restrictions for Use

Standardized Ginkgo biloba extract (GBE) eligibility is strictly defined by regulatory authorities, with use permitted primarily for adults and the elderly.


Populations for Whom Use is Prohibited or Not Established

Category Regulatory Status (Example Authority)
Contraindicated Pregnant individuals (due to increased bleeding risk); Patients with known hypersensitivity to the extract or excipients.
Not Recommended Children and adolescents under 18 years (due to lack of sufficient data); Breastfeeding individuals.

Conditions Requiring Special Precaution

Official regulatory documents require that GBE only be used under special precaution or after consultation for certain conditions:

  • Patients with a pathologically increased bleeding tendency (haemorrhagic diathesis).
  • Individuals receiving anticoagulant or antiplatelet treatments.
  • Patients with epilepsy, as the product may influence seizure susceptibility.
  • Individuals scheduled for surgery; the product should be discontinued 3 to 4 days prior to the procedure.

These regulatory classifications establish who can safely be considered for use and who must avoid the medicine based entirely on official label text.

What should I know about interactions with other medicines?

Interactions with other medicines and products

Official regulatory documents characterize the interaction profile of Ginkgo Biloba extract (GBE) through a combination of pharmacodynamic and pharmacokinetic effects with specific drug classes and substances.

Interaction Scope

Property Value
Medicinal product categories with documented interactions: Anticoagulants, Antiplatelet drugs, Cytochrome P450 (CYP) Substrates, Anticonvulsants.
Specific interacting medicines (if explicitly listed): Warfarin, Aspirin, Clopidogrel, Omeprazole, Nifedipine, Simvastatin, Alprazolam.
Mechanistic basis of interactions (only if stated in label): Pharmacodynamic interaction leading to additive anti-clotting effects; Pharmacokinetic interaction involving CYP enzyme modulation (e.g., induction of CYP2C19, potential modulation of CYP3A4).

Official Interaction Statements

  • Co-administration with Anticoagulants (e.g., Warfarin) and Antiplatelet drugs (e.g., Aspirin) is documented to pose an increased risk of bleeding due to an additive pharmacodynamic effect.
  • GBE is reported to act as an inducer of Cytochrome P450 2C19 (CYP2C19), which may lead to a decrease in the plasma concentration of medicines that are substrates for this enzyme (e.g., Omeprazole).
  • An interaction with Nifedipine is documented, which may cause increased exposure (plasma levels) of Nifedipine.
  • Co-administration may interfere with the action of Anticonvulsants, potentially leading to an increased risk of seizure activity.

Procedural and Restriction Notes

The documented bleeding risk associated with GBE necessitates a procedural constraint: the extract must be discontinued at least two weeks prior to elective surgical or dental procedures. Caution is also required when co-administering GBE with other herbal products or supplements that affect blood coagulation (e.g., Garlic, Ginger) due to a cumulative risk.

Dosage and Administration Information

The usage of standardized Ginkgo biloba extract (GBE) is characterized by specific parameters regarding its administration, dose, and duration of use. The extract is available in solid forms, such as tablets and capsules, for the administration of the medicine.


Administration Scope Guideline
Route of administration The medicine is for oral use only.
Dosing schedule The standard daily dose of dry extract is typically in the range of 120 mg to 240 mg.
Timing in relation to meals There are no specific instructions regarding the intake with or without food.
Age-group rules Dosing is designated for adults and the elderly. Use in children and adolescents under 18 years of age is not established and is not recommended.

The total daily dose is intended for administration in 2 to 3 divided doses across the day. This schedule ensures the active constituents—specifically the flavone glycosides and terpene lactones—are delivered according to product standardization requirements.

Course Duration and Procedural Conditions

The treatment course typically lasts for a minimum period of 8 weeks before the regimen's response is assessed. If no symptomatic improvement has occurred, the continuation of the treatment course is generally re-evaluated after 3 months of continuous use. Use beyond certain durations is associated with medical consultation. This structure defines the use of the medicine within a controlled therapeutic cycle.

Recent Clinical Evidence

Research Evidence / Overview of Studies for Ginkgo Biloba


Evidence for Use in Age-Related Cognitive Impairment

Standardized Ginkgo Biloba extract was evaluated in studies exploring outcomes in older adults experiencing mild age-related cognitive impairment and symptoms associated with mild-to-moderate dementia. Research includes randomized controlled trials (RCTs) focusing on measuring changes in cognitive function scores, such as memory and processing speed. Findings were mixed; some trials reported measured changes, while larger, longer-term prevention studies were inconsistent regarding observed patterns. The evidence quality varies across studies, and certainty remains low concerning long-term impact or prevention of decline.


Evidence for Use in Circulatory Disorders and Leg Pain

Research was evaluated in studies exploring conditions marked by functional limitations related to circulation, specifically for individuals with chronic peripheral arterial issues. RCTs evaluated functional measures, such as tracking changes in pain-free walking distance. Findings describe patterns observed in the studies over a medium-term duration. For minor symptoms like cold extremities, the evidence is limited to data gathered from its long-standing traditional use, and scientific reviews have noted that some foundational evidence quality varies across studies due to methodological issues.


Evidence for Use in Vertigo and Tinnitus

Ginkgo Biloba was studied for its application in conditions associated with fluctuating or episodic manifestations, specifically vertigo (dizziness) and tinnitus (ringing in the ears). Research in this area has resulted in mixed findings across RCTs, which monitored changes in the reported intensity of symptoms. The available evidence base is limited, and scientific reviews have consistently noted inconsistencies in the results. This inconsistency is noted in scientific reviews and may be linked to heterogeneity in how outcomes were measured.


Evidence in Specific Populations

Studies were also evaluated in healthy adults who did not have a diagnosis of cognitive impairment. Research in this population examined specific functions like memory and attention. Findings indicated that effects observed were associated with non-significant measurements on key cognitive performance tasks for these healthy groups. Overall, results apply only to the populations studied.


What Remains Uncertain and Areas for Future Research

A significant limitation across the research is the variability across studies, particularly for cognitive function. Long-term effects are not fully established for most uses, and comparative evidence is lacking in some areas. Research is ongoing, particularly to fill gaps where data for certain groups remain insufficient.

Frequently Asked Questions (FAQ)

Common questions about Ginkgo Biloba (FAQ)


Q: Can Ginkgo Biloba be taken with blood pressure medicine?

A: Official product information indicates a potential interaction with certain blood pressure lowering medicines, such as Nifedipine. This interaction may result in an increase in the blood levels of the blood pressure medicine. Official information suggests caution and monitoring when these medicines are used together.


Q: Are there any common foods or drinks that interact with Ginkgo Biloba?

A: Regulatory documents advise caution regarding the consumption of alcohol while using Ginkgo Biloba due to reports of a potential disulfiram-like reaction. Official warnings state that the raw or roasted seeds of the Ginkgo plant are toxic and are not for ingestion.


Q: What is the difference between Ginkgo Biloba extract and the raw leaf?

A: The extract used in medicinal products is a standardized product, meaning it is chemically processed to contain a precise, consistent percentage of active components like flavonol glycosides. This standardization ensures purity and minimal levels of potentially harmful compounds, such as ginkgolic acids. The raw leaf or unprocessed plant parts lack this controlled standardization and may contain higher levels of potentially harmful compounds.


Q: Do older adults need to be more careful about using Ginkgo Biloba?

A: Official regulatory information designates the product for use in both adults and the elderly. While this is the intended user group, general caution is advised for all patients, especially regarding the risk of interactions with concurrent medications. Older adults are generally encouraged to be cautious due to potential susceptibility to interaction risks, as noted in general warnings.


Q: Can women who are pregnant or breastfeeding use Ginkgo Biloba?

A: According to official product labels, use of Ginkgo Biloba is contraindicated, or strongly advised against, during pregnancy. Official product information notes that safety and efficacy data regarding use during breastfeeding are currently unpublished.


Q: Does Ginkgo Biloba interact with common pain relievers like ibuprofen?

A: Official warnings indicate that combining Ginkgo Biloba with Non-Steroidal Anti-Inflammatory Drugs (NSAIDs), which includes common pain relievers like Ibuprofen, may pose an increased risk. This combination is associated with an additive effect, potentially increasing the risk of bleeding.


Q: Is there a maximum amount of time a person should take Ginkgo Biloba?

A: There is no single, universally established maximum duration for using Ginkgo Biloba extract. Clinical studies have examined the safe use of the extract in adults for periods of up to six years. The recommended treatment protocol suggests that a healthcare professional reassess the continuation of use after a minimum three-month period.


Q: Are there different forms of Ginkgo Biloba supplements (pills, liquid, tea)?

A: Standardized Ginkgo Biloba extract is manufactured into several different forms for oral use. These commonly include tablets and capsules, as well as liquid or powder extracts. Some forms of tea are also available.


Q: Are there any reported interactions between Ginkgo Biloba and certain herbal teas?

A: Official information suggests caution when combining Ginkgo Biloba with other herbal products, particularly those known to affect blood clotting. While specific data is sparse for most common herbal teas, some research has explored potential interactions with products like Green Tea.


Q: Are there specific countries where Ginkgo Biloba is approved for certain treatments?

A: Yes, the regulatory status of Ginkgo Biloba extract varies globally. In several countries, particularly within Europe, a standardized extract such as EGb 761 is formally approved as a medicine. This approval is for the treatment of symptoms associated with conditions like cognitive decline, peripheral circulatory disorders, tinnitus, and vertigo.


Q: Does Ginkgo Biloba interact with antidepressants or mood stabilizers?

A: Official regulatory reports indicate a potential for interaction between Ginkgo Biloba and certain central nervous system (CNS) medications, including some antidepressants like Trazodone or Amitriptyline. This combination may be associated with a potential reduction in the antidepressant’s effectiveness or an increased risk of seizure activity.


Q: Can Ginkgo Biloba interfere with the effects of vitamins or other supplements?

A: Ginkgo Biloba contains a substance called Ginkgotoxin, which has been investigated for potential antagonism with Vitamin B6 (pyridoxine). Official documents suggest caution and monitoring when the extract is combined with any other vitamins or supplements.


Q: What is the difference between EGb 761 and other Ginkgo extracts?

A: EGb 761 is the trade name for a specific, highly controlled extract that is used as a reference for clinical studies and in medicinal products worldwide. It is differentiated from general extracts because it adheres to a highly precise formula, containing specific controlled levels of flavonoid glycosides and terpene lactones.


Q: Does taking Ginkgo Biloba affect my ability to drive or operate machines?

A: Although there is no specific blanket warning against operating machinery, official documentation lists dizziness and headache as common side effects. Official labels state that patients should monitor their individual response before engaging in activities that require mental alertness, such as driving.


Q: Has Ginkgo Biloba been studied for its use in eye conditions?

A: Research has examined the potential role of Ginkgo Biloba extract in certain eye conditions. These studies have specifically explored the extract's ability to protect against retinal degenerative diseases and improve ocular blood flow in conditions like Normal-Tension Glaucoma (NTG).


Q: Can Ginkgo Biloba affect sleep patterns, making you more or less sleepy?

A: The most frequently reported side effects do not typically include changes to sleep patterns like general drowsiness. However, official safety data has documented rare adverse event reports, such as those related to obstructive sleep apnoea syndrome.


Q: What does the research say about Ginkgo Biloba and anxiety or stress?

A: While not a primary approved use, research has explored the anti-stress potential of Ginkgo Biloba extract. Studies in this area have specifically focused on its observed effects on stress response pathways and certain neurotransmitter systems.


Q: Does Ginkgo Biloba have an impact on blood sugar levels?

A: Official drug interaction information highlights that Ginkgo Biloba may potentially interact with diabetes medications. If used alongside diabetes medications, professional monitoring of blood sugar levels is necessary, as there is a potential for a change in glucose response.


Q: What is the typical timeframe for reported side effects after starting Ginkgo?

A: According to analysis from adverse event reports, the median timeframe for the onset of reported side effects is typically 7 days after starting treatment. The data suggests that most reactions are reported within the first week of using the product.


Q: Can someone who is vegetarian or vegan use most Ginkgo Biloba products?

A: The active ingredient in Ginkgo Biloba extract is derived from the plant's leaves, making the active substance itself plant-based. However, the composition of the capsule, tablets, or other delivery forms may vary. Individuals can refer to the product label for specific confirmation that the product uses vegan-friendly ingredients.


Q: Why is the Ginkgo seed or fruit often considered toxic?

A: The raw or roasted seeds and the surrounding fruit pulp are considered toxic because they contain compounds such as the neurotoxin Ginkgotoxin (4'-O-methylpyridoxine). These toxic substances are associated with the risk of poisoning.


Q: Are there any interactions with common over-the-counter cold medicines?

A: Official regulatory guidance advises general caution when combining Ginkgo Biloba with any medications, including those purchased over-the-counter (OTC) for cold symptoms. This general caution is due to the potential for drug-drug interactions.


How should Gingko Biloba be stored and disposed of?

The storage and disposal of standardized Ginkgo Biloba Extract (GBE) must adhere strictly to conditions outlined in regulatory labeling to maintain product quality and ensure safety.

Storage and Protection

The product must be kept in a cool dark place and protected from light and heat. To maintain integrity, the container cap must be closed tightly after use, and the product must not be used if the cap seal is broken or missing. As a mandatory safety requirement, the medicine must be stored out of reach of children.

Disposal Requirements

Official instructions require that unused, expired, or unwanted contents and containers must be disposed of in accordance with local regulation. This ensures compliance with pharmaceutical waste standards and prevents environmental contamination.
